One thing to be aware Sticky, is that the original bush is a jolly tight fit in the ram eye, hence needing mandrels or a press to do the job...

I turned up one of the mandrels I use on the lathe but if you have a good assortment of sockets and a length of threaded bar and thick washers you'll be fine...
